About this House

The Muirfield—a smartly designed 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ath home offering 1,512 total square feet, complete with an oversized two-car garage and additional driveway parking. As you enter from the covered front porch, you’re welcomed by the kitchen featuring a pantry and island, with an adjacent powder bath for guests. The open-concept layout includes a dining nook and living space ideal for everyday comfort and entertaining. The mechanical room is conveniently located near the garage entry, offering extra storage options. Upstairs, enjoy the flexibility of a spacious bonus loft—perfect for a second living area, playroom, or office—plus a built-in desk cutout ideal for work or study. The upper level includes a linen closet, two generously sized secondary bedrooms with a shared bath featuring a soaker tub, and a designated laundry room. The private en-suite primary bedroom offers a large walk-in closet, dual vanities, and a stand-up shower. This home is packed with high-efficiency and smart features, including a tankless water heater, radon mitigation system, perimeter sump pump, central air conditioning, solar conduit, and an electric vehicle charging station in the garage. Enjoy added peace of mind and convenience with the Smart Home package, which includes a video doorbell, smart thermostat, keyless smart locks, smart light switches, and hands-free front door access. Located in the growing Settlers Crossing community, you’ll enjoy walking trails, a community park, neighborhood events, and easy access to Denver International Airport, shopping, and dining. ***Estimated Delivery Date: December.
